    After the Snowden leaks, I analyzed FISA court appointments and discovered that Chief Justice Roberts had stacked the court. All 11 of the FISA judges at that moment were Republican-selected judges. This is from my book Power Wars. /2

      @SenBlumenthal proposed legislation to break up that concentrated power and ensure greater ideological diversity on who becomes a FISA Court judge, but the idea didn't get traction in that reform moment and faded away. /3
